The Hoy Ferry
(2026)(The fifth book in the Freya Tulloch Orkney Mystery series)
A novel by Phillip Strang
The first ferry from Stromness to Hoy is a small, practical service. The ferryman knows every face.
This morning, there is only one passenger. She has no ticket. He never saw her board.
She has been dead for thirty‑six hours.
Jean Isbister left Hoy twenty years ago and never meant to return. Three days ago, she came back to the croft she inherited from her uncle and found what he had kept for her: a record of the event that drove her off the island, and the names of the people responsible. Those people are still on Hoy. They built their lives on the assumption that Jean Isbister would stay gone. She didn’t. She gave them the chance to put things right.
DI Freya Tulloch knows the water, but not this island. Constable Billy Flett does. Hoy is his place, his people, his history. For the first time in the investigation, Freya follows.
The Hoy Ferry is the fifth Freya Tulloch Orkney Mystery quiet, exact, and set on the most dramatic island in an archipelago that has never lacked for drama.
